Creative Talent Acquisition Approaches

To draw in top talent, companies need to reconsider standard recruiting practices and utilize novel sourcing strategies. Utilizing digital platforms for recruitment has emerged as a game-changer. Recruiters can interact with prospective employees in informal settings, highlight company culture, and reach a larger audience. Customizing content to specific demographics on platforms like Instagram, TikTok, or TikTok can appeal to candidates who may not be proactively seeking new positions but are interested in interacting with a brand that aligns with them.

Another effective tactic is capitalizing on employee referrals. Encouraging current employees to refer candidates creates a more intimate connection between job applicants and the business. By rewarding referrals, organizations can leverage their employees' contacts, finding talent that matches with the company's values and workplace. This method not only accelerates the hiring process but often leads to enhanced retention rates, as referred employees tend to have a more suitable cultural fit.

Lastly, exploring alliances with local educational institutions can be a beneficial avenue for sourcing talent. Internship programs, co-op placements, and participation in employment events allow companies to build relationships with pupils and recent graduates. By interacting early with up-and-coming talent, organizations can create a flow of skilled candidates who are already familiar with the company and its mission, making them more likely to dedicate to a long-term position once they finish school.

Elevating Candidate Engagement

Developing a positive candidate experience is essential in drawing top talent. From the very first interaction, candidates should experience valued and respected. This can be accomplished by guaranteeing clear communication throughout the recruitment process. Timely updates about submission status and feedback after interviews can substantially enhance their experience. A welcoming approach not only creates a positive impression but also demonstrates the company culture, which is an attractive aspect for potential employees.

Incorporating technology can streamline the application process, making it more efficient for candidates. A user-friendly online application system, virtual interviews, and automated scheduling tools can help minimize the time and effort needed to apply. Providing resources such as video tutorials on the application process or FAQs about company culture can additional assist candidates. Optimizing this process shows that the company is thoughtful of applicants' time and needs.

Finally, involving candidates post-application is just as vital as the initial stages. Sending customized messages expressing gratitude to them for their application, inviting them to network on professional platforms, or offering virtual connection opportunities can help keep them involved. Even if the outcome is not positive, maintaining a positive relationship can turn candidates into brand advocates and enhance your reputation in the job market.
